• The British moved theiradministrative centre in KualaKubu Bharu on May 6, 1931.The town is located in thenortheastern part of the Stateof Selangor in sub-district ofAmpang Pecah.

• Located at a very strategiclocation near the state border,KKB has become a transit pointfor tourists who are heading toFraser’s Hill in the state ofPahang, while also being atourist destination in itself.

Memelihara Warisan: Lukisan Terukur

Mendokumantasikan senibina Bangunan Warisanmenggunakan teknik Lukisan Terukur.

Lukisan Terukur ialah; mendokumen nilai istimewasesebuah bangunan dari segi sejarah, lukisan binaan danteknologi binaan sesebuah bangunan.

Lukisan meliputi; pelan lokasi, pelan tapak, pelan-pelan,keratan, tampak dan butiran beserta spesifikasinya.

Stage 1:The reviews were made through the conversation with thelocals, neighborhood, historian .

Stage 2:The on site measurements were collected using differentinstruments or machines such as sky lift, theodolite,distometer, range pole and Barton comb. Graphics and photoswere documented as references. The measurement work wasaid by apparatus such as measuring tape, scale ruler andcompact folding ladder.

Stage 3:More detailed research was done through the searching inthe library in Kuala Kubu Bharu , visit to the Pejabat Tanah aswell as Majlis KKB and Arkib Negara.

Stage 4:Prepare full set of measured Drawings in studio.

Stage 5: Prepare Measured Drawing report.

MASJID AMPANG PECAHThe Old Mosque of Ampang Pecah islocated in Kampung Ampang Pechah,Kuala Kubu Bharu. It was first built in1926, under the surveillance of Britishauthorities but completely self-budgeted.Looking a long way back in 19th

centuries, during the opening of theKuala Kubu town, it was said that thepeople who settled here comes fromthe Sumatran Island, Indonesia.

Looking from the exterior perspective, GaleriSejarah KKB, indeed portrays the ordinaryimage of how a traditional Malay houseshould. The application of the proportionaldivision is done properly covering from theapex of the roof to the footing stump (brickpedestals) on the ground.

In terms of the infill walls, the timber panels are assembled horizontally. According totraditional Malay construction, the use of horizontal wall panels indicates that theowner of the house is of average-income with the rational that timber panels which arearranged in horizontal manner are much cheaper and require shorter pieces of planks,rather than to vertical organization which depends on longer pieces of timber panels.This theory is somewhat relevant if we consider the fact that house was preliminarybuilt for secondary-class workers for the government (Rahim Mohamad, 2014).

6 Class X Quarters along Jalan Syed Mahsor was built duringBritish colonial in 1932 as part of the town planning at that time.It is called 6 Class X Quarters because they consist of 6 units in onebuilding and each building can accommodate 6 families. Thequarters were for low post government servants (Grade One) suchas office boys or gardeners.

The size of a unit for a family was very small as it consisted onlyone room for the whole family. The material used was timbercompared to the others which used masonry. In this case, we cansee this is only for the low post government servants.

PEJABAT DAERAH Special Features of Pejabat Daerah danTanah Hulu Selangor• U-shaped plan, consisting of a main block

with east and west wing . All three (3)office blocks are arranged in a way toform an outdoor space in the middle,which is the cortile.

• This office was constructed in bricks withtiled roof and floors as required by FrankSwettenham, who earlier stated“buildings should be constructed of bricksand tiles.

• Standing two (2) level high with doublevolume in each level, the building reacheda height of approximately 49’ 9”(approximately 15 metres) for all officeblocks and 41’ 11” (approximately 12metres) at the stair towers.

• Located at the hilltop, this office was astrategic location to control all activitiesof the city.

BALAI BOMBA• Kuala Kubu Fire Station was the

old fire station which located inthe middle of the town have beenbuilt around 1930 and it was theoldest fire station in the region ofHulu Selangor.

• It is so special in which it has thephysical aspects of a typicalVictorian building, with the effortin combining and adapting to thetropical climate.
